Step 6 of the Burrowdale deploy: wire up PoolGate, our pgbouncer-ish connection pooler. Quick note for the security reviewer — the pooler authenticates to the primary with a dedicated credential, scoped read-write, rotated monthly by the Kestrel infra crew. App pods never see the raw DB password, only the pooler does. On the pooler host, append this line to /etc/poolgate/.env:

vault entry, yahaf-tagug: LEDGER_TOKEN20=884d77d1a8b98aa4edfb

Subject: Quickstore 4.2 — bloom filter now fronts the KV layer

Plugin authors: starting with this release, Quickstore places a bloom filter ahead of the key-value store. Negative lookups return faster; false positives fall through safely. No API changes are required on your side. Verify your plugin against the staging build referenced below.

session token of fahif-tadup = htk3_9c7

Subject: Cut-over complete — Larkfield health checks

Hi all — quick summary for new folks. Last night we moved the Larkfield API behind the new Trenholm load balancer. Health checks now hit a dedicated readiness endpoint instead of the root path, which was waking the whole app on every probe. Thresholds were loosened so a single slow response no longer ejects a node. Rollback took under five minutes in rehearsal. The health check configuration now in effect is shown below.

deployment values, yadug-bawif:
[framir]
team = pelox
access_code = ac_a38ab2
owner = tamion.julael
host = framir.tolvaqlabs.test
port = 11211
peer = tammir.zemvargrid.local
salt = 2215ef03
pin = 1541

### Step 3: Enable Rate Limiting

The Torvane gateway enforces per-tenant rate limits. Support: if customers report 429s, check `RATE_LIMIT_RPS` before escalating. Default is 50. Edit `/etc/torvane/gateway.env`, set `RATE_LIMIT_ENABLED=true` and `RATE_LIMIT_RPS=50`, then restart the service. The limiter shares state via Redis, which requires an auth token in the same file. Add that token on the following line:

secret setting of yajog-taguf: ARCHIVE_KEY3=051